Hello Lanceracer66,
Your Diagnostic Report suggests there is a problem with Vista's Licensing Store. Please try the below steps to recreate the Store.
1) Click the option that opens an Internet Browser window.
2) Type: %windir%\system32 into the browser address bar. (Does not work in FireFox browsers)
3) Find the file CMD.exe
4) Right-Click on CMD.exe and select 'Run as Administrator'
5) Type: net stop slsvc (it may ask you if you are sure, select yes)
6) Type: cd %windir%\ServiceProfiles\NetworkService\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\SoftwareLicensing
7) Type: rename tokens.dat tokens.bar
8) Type: cd %windir%\system32
9) Type: net start slsvc
10) Type: cscript slmgr.vbs -rilc (It may take a long time for this to complete, please be patient)
11) Restart your computer twice.
12) You may be required to enter the Product Key and/or Activate.Thank you,
